引言:本文围绕 TPWallet 对 Filecoin (FIL) 的支持,从安全漏洞识别、创新技术应用、行业发展、性能优化、热钱包风险与防护、实时交易监控六大维度进行系统分析,提出可行性改进建议,供产品、研发与安全团队参考。
一、安全漏洞(风险面与缓解)
1) 密钥管理风险:热钱包私钥长期在线易被提取。缓解:使用阈值签名(TSS/MPC)、HSM 或分布式密钥管理,减少单点泄露。2) 签名与交易构造错误:不正确的 nonce、gas 估算或消息格式导致重放、卡单或资金损失。缓解:严格遵循 Filecoin 消息格式、增强本地模拟与签名前校验。3) 依赖链与第三方服务:RPC 节点、浏览器扩展或 SDK 漏洞可能成为攻击面。缓解:多节点冗余、RPC 访问白名单、签名隔离与依赖审计。4) 社会工程与钓鱼:用户被诱导导出种子或批准交易。缓解:交易详情可视化、权限最小化、二次确认与时间锁。

二、创新型科技应用(提升安全与体验)

1) 阈值签名与多方计算(MPC):实现无单点私钥、在线签名高可用,兼顾体验与安全。2) 安全芯片/HSM 集成:关键操作在可信执行环境中完成,降低主机被攻破后的风险。3) FVM 与智能合约工具链:借助 FVM 自动化管理多方签名逻辑、批量提现策略与策略合约。4) 零知识与隐私保护:部分场景中引入 zk 技术保护交易隐私与审计最小化。
三、行业发展剖析(Filecoin 生态与钱包角色)
1) 存储经济与代币流动性:随着存储市场和 DeFi 协同,FIL 的链上流动性与跨链桥需求增长,钱包需支持跨链与桥接安全策略。2) 节点客户端差异:Lotus、Venus、Forest 等实现差异要求钱包适配多种 RPC 行为与重组处理。3) 监管与合规趋势:KYC/AML 要求可能影响热钱包的设计与提现策略,需兼顾隐私与合规。
四、高效能技术服务(高并发与稳定性)
1) 并发签名与批处理:通过批量签名、交易池优化减少 RPC 调用与链上拥堵成本。2) 缓存与索引:构建本地索引器、状态缓存与增量更新,降低链查询延迟。3) 异步处理与回滚策略:队列化消息提交、重试与幂等处理以应对链重组与失败。4) 灾备与可观察性:多可用区部署、指标采集(Prometheus/Grafana)、告警与 SLO 管理。
五、热钱包专项分析(风险、设计与运营)
1) 风险特征:私钥在线、频繁签名、对外开放接口。2) 设计原则:最小权限原则(白名单地址、额度上限)、每日/单笔限额、审批流程、时间锁与多签组合。3) 运维策略:密钥轮换、访问日志与快照、应急手段(冷钱包离线签名流程)。
六、实时交易监控(技术实现与响应流程)
1) Mempool 与链上监听:构建 mempool 监控、pending 交易追踪、链上确认次数统计,及时发现异常重放或卡单。2) 异常检测:基于规则(大额、速率突增、黑名单到达)与 ML 异常检测结合,触发自动化阻断或人工复核。3) 自动化恢复:当检测到交易失败或链分叉,自动重构交易(调整 gas/gas-fee)或回退用户状态,并通知用户与安全团队。4) 全链路审计:记录签名上下文、交易详情、IP 与操作人,满足事后取证与合规要求。
结论与建议:
- 短期(3个月):引入多重限额、增强交易详情可视化、建立多节点 RPC 与监控告警体系。
- 中期(6-12个月):部署阈值签名/MPC 方案、HSM 集成、构建本地索引与批处理服务、完善应急离线签名流程。
- 长期(12个月以上):探索 FVM 助力的自动化合约策略、跨链安全桥接与基于行为的智能风控模型。
TPWallet 在支持 FIL 的实践中,需将安全优先与用户体验并重。采用分层防护、先进的密钥管理技术、完善的实时监控与自动化响应体系,才能在 Filecoin 生态快速发展中保障资产安全并提供高效服务。
评论
AlexChen
文章条理很清晰,特别赞同阈值签名和MPC的落地建议。
王晓雨
关于实时监控部分能再列举几个常用异常检测指标吗?很实用。
DataMiner
建议补充对 Lotus 与其他客户端在消息处理差异的具体兼容策略。
小赵
热钱包限额+多签是当前最可行的短期方案,感谢总结。
CryptoLuca
希望能看到关于跨链桥接安全的更多细节,比如桥中继与仲裁机制。